Transaction 656f6834bd95bba9fbb1ec7115da98848b2b4aabef08fe51dbfe535a8a35f6d6
1 Input
1 Output
-
656f6834bd95bba9fbb1ec7115da98848b2b4aabef08fe51dbfe535a8a35f6d6:0
- value
- 113000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 573b304a5e756626a94b0363acf8592514a95fa1 OP_EQUAL
- address
- 39eFcjNpjRyaab8h3v61UTSonx2VumJBxj